What does a network tester do?

The network tester provides you with important information about wiring errors. Network testers can be used to identify, analyze and solve connection problems. Network testers can be used to quickly and easily check whether a wire is continuous, interrupted or short-circuited.

What are network testers used for?

Network testers are used for installation and troubleshooting in telephone, network and low-voltage electrical installations, among other things. These devices can test network cables quickly and easily. Among other things, they can check CAT, COAX and fiber optic cables for wiring errors and malfunctions.

In principle, a network tester helps you (especially for new installations) to check the requirements of the installation. Use cases include cable breaks, short circuits, faults, incorrect assignments or split pairs.

How does a network tester work?

The network tester sends a pulse through the network that is reflected by faulty points.

How does a network tester display faults?

The integrated display graphically shows the cable status and fault details. Many models also have an easy-to-read color display with backlighting. You can then save the measured value in the network tester's internal memory.

Network testers usually also offer very useful analysis software. You can use this software to evaluate the data on a computer, for example, and then print it out.

What are the advantages of a network tester?

With a network tester, you can identify sources of error within your network more quickly, easily and reliably, saving you time and effort while effectively reducing your operating costs and increasing network availability.

It is essential to comprehensively check and document the requirements specified by the customer for the acceptance test. A network tester makes this process easier. At the same time, network testers are a helpful tool for IT support services - errors such as network faults can be detected with network testers, allowing you to reduce downtime and save money.

What types of network testers are there?

In general, network testers can be divided into one of 3 categories: Cable Certification Testers, Cable Qualification Testers and Cable Verification Testers.

Cable Qualification Testers

Cable Qualification Testers are primarily intended for network analysis in existing Ethernet networks.

This type of network tester can be used to determine whether a line achieves the required network speed for Fast Ethernet, Voice over IP or Gigabit Ethernet. Use cases for this scenario are, for example, after a network upgrade or expansion.

You can also use a cable qualification tester to check whether the existing cabling is suitable for a higher transmission speed.

Many devices also allow you to test for length, open circuits, short circuits and reversed pairs. Errors are shown graphically on the tester's display.

Verification tester

A verification tester shows you whether a faulty or disconnected cable is responsible for faults in the network. Applications include switch ports and cable tests.

Cable certification testers

Cable certification testers help you to check the specifications of network cabling with regard to a norm or standard.

What should I consider when buying a network tester?

The location and measurement objective are decisive factors when choosing a new network tester. Therefore, these two criteria should be clearly defined BEFORE purchasing the network tester. Among other things, this will determine whether you need a network tester for verification, certification and cable qualification.

Network testers with a high-quality graphical display that clearly and concisely shows you the network errors are significantly more expensive than conventional products. Depending on the application, such a graphical display - depending on the form & variant - can drive up the price.

You should also find out whether you need analysis software. A connection to a PC including a software-driven evaluation supports you in data analysis, processing and documentation.
